HIP 49761
HIP 49761 is a G-type (Yellow) star located in the constellation Ursa Major.
Located approximately 413.9 light-years from Earth, HIP 49761 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 49761 is classified as a spectral class G star (G-type (Yellow)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 49761 has an apparent magnitude of +9.38,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its yellow h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.901.
